2002 SYM RV 150 review from Malaysia

"Good"

What things have gone wrong with the motorcycle?

This scooter hasn't had any problem in a year, but just the speedometer cable had broken at 15000KM.

General comments?

It has poor fuel economy for a 150cc 4T 4 valve single cylinder water-cooled engine, the consumption is about 20KM/L.

The plastic of this scooter looks very cheap.

The suspension is too hard when on bumpy roads. Other than this, it can go 130KM/h and normally cruises at 100KM/h. Quite stable on speedway, but the handling is not as good as my previous ZZR.
